Mechanism of Action: Phytoestrogens and Vasomotor Stability

Phytoestrogens are plant-derived polyphenolic compounds that share a striking structural similarity with 17β-estradiol, the primary form of human endogenous estrogen. This molecular resemblance allows these compounds to bind to estrogen receptors throughout the body, specifically the ER-α and ER-β subtypes. By occupying these sites, they can provide a stabilizing "SERM-like" (Selective Estrogen Receptor Modulator) effect. In environments where estrogen levels are low, these plant compounds may act as weak agonists to modulate the body's estrogenic response. This mechanism can help mitigate the physiological "peaks and valleys" that characterize the menopausal transition. Primary botanical sources of these stabilizing compounds include soy, flaxseeds, and various legumes. Utilizing Phytoestrogens for Menopause as a clinical intervention may affect the intensity of vasomotor episodes by providing a more consistent hormonal signal to the brain's regulatory centers.

The Clinical Role of Soy Isoflavones

Soy contains high concentrations of genistein and daidzein, two isoflavones with significant biological activity. These specific compounds interact with receptors in the vascular system and the brain to support systemic balance. Clinical evidence suggests that consistent isoflavone intake can affect the frequency of night sweats and hot flashes by supporting the hypothalamus's temperature-regulating functions. Modern research has largely debunked previous safety concerns, showing that whole soy consumption is appropriate and safe for most menopausal women. The Estrobolome: Gut Health and Hormonal Balance

The metabolic pathway of plant-based estrogens is deeply influenced by the estrobolome, which is a specialized collection of gut bacteria. These microbes are responsible for metabolizing and recirculating estrogen within the body to maintain hormonal equilibrium. A high-fiber plant-based diet can affect the diversity and efficiency of the estrobolome, ensuring that phytoestrogens are converted into their most active forms, such as equol. If the gut environment is compromised, the body may fail to utilize these botanical nutrients effectively, potentially leading to increased symptom severity. This highlights the cause-and-effect link between digestive health and systemic hormonal balance. Can a plant-based diet really reduce hot flashes?

A plant-based framework can affect the frequency and intensity of hot flashes by providing stabilizing isoflavones. Research, such as the WAVS trial, indicates that a low-fat vegan diet supplemented with cooked soybeans can reduce total hot flashes by 79%. This occurs because specific plant compounds may bind to estrogen receptors, providing a consistent hormonal signal. These dietary shifts support the hypothalamus's temperature regulation mechanism and promote overall systemic balance during the transition.

Do I need to eat soy to see benefits in menopause symptoms?

While soy is a highly concentrated source of genistein and daidzein, it is not the only option for botanical support. Flaxseeds, sesame seeds, and legumes also provide lignans and isoflavones that may affect hormonal signaling. However, soy remains the most clinically studied intervention for vasomotor relief. Can plant-based supplements replace hormone replacement therapy?

Plant-based interventions and hormone replacement therapy (HRT) function through different physiological mechanisms. While phytoestrogen supplements for menopause may provide a stabilizing effect on mild to moderate symptoms, they are not a direct bioidentical replacement for systemic hormones. These botanical options are often utilized by women who seek natural alternatives or who have contraindications for HRT. You should consult with a healthcare provider to determine the most appropriate clinical path for your specific health profile.
